Looking ahead to 2026, this momentum is set to accelerate, solidifying metal biocides as an indispensable tool in the battle against microbes.Metal biocides are compounds that leverage the antimicrobial properties of various metals to effectively combat bacteria, algae, fungi, and other microorganisms. These biocides are widely used in a diverse range of applications, including industrial water treatment, paints and coatings, healthcare, and agriculture. Their effectiveness, broad spectrum of action, and long-lasting protection make them a vital component in preventing microbial growth and ensuring the safety and performance of various products and systems. However, the industry is constantly evolving to address concerns regarding environmental impact, regulatory scrutiny, and the emergence of antimicrobial resistance. As a result, the metal biocides market is undergoing a period of significant innovation, focusing on developing more targeted, sustainable, and environmentally friendly solutions.

Eco-Friendly Alternatives
The industry is actively seeking out and developing metal biocides with reduced environmental impact. This involves exploring alternative metal compounds, optimizing formulations to minimize the use of toxic components, and investigating novel delivery systems that enhance efficacy while minimizing environmental release.Targeted Action and Reduced Resistance
The emergence of antimicrobial resistance is a growing concern. The industry is focusing on developing biocides with targeted action, specifically designed to combat specific microbial strains. This approach minimizes the risk of resistance development and ensures long-term efficacy.Advanced Delivery Systems
Innovative delivery systems are being developed to enhance the efficacy of metal biocides, ensuring better control over their release, improving their effectiveness, and extending their lifespan. This includes microencapsulation, nanoparticles, and controlled-release technologies.Drivers
